Output 3eb591584df84df94f389e15aceca8c11589d701b1a5aad6bcdbe43b2a236293:1

value
11024637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f838518d08cd2e54b934c8c6301b7b7d3681d3c OP_EQUALVERIFY OP_CHECKSIG
address
FiFYdWFwBTA2ikZC99Ynikj6vqpAKk2s29
transaction
3eb591584df84df94f389e15aceca8c11589d701b1a5aad6bcdbe43b2a236293